World pharmacist day is celebrated on September 25 annually to spread awareness, show pharmacists contribution and how they help in improving health. The founder of World Pharmacists Day, the International Pharmaceutical Federation (FIP Founded in 1912) is the global body representing pharmacy, pharmaceutical sciences, and pharmaceutical education. The objective of this celebration is to promote and support the role of these professionals in disease prevention, health promotion and treatment follow-up worldwide.

However, they announce different theme in every year but, this year (2020) theme is “Transforming global health“. It is an initiative to improve the state of healthcare globally. Now, work of pharmacists is even more important as they fulfill a mission of health advice, advice on medicines, vaccination, etc.

Why 25 September celebrated as world pharmacist day?

World Pharmacist's Day was established by the International Pharmaceutical Federation or FIP. This took place during a Council held in September 2009 in Istanbul, Turkey. The date 25 September was chosen to commemorate the day on which the organization was created.

International Federation of Pharmacists (FIP) This non-governmental organization brings together various associations of pharmacologists and pharmacists from around the world. It was founded on September 25, 1912 in The Hague (Netherlands) and today represents more than four million professionals.

The FIP has collaborated with the World Health Organization (WHO) and various governments of the world, offering technical expertise and implementing joint projects, as well as contributing to action plans that seek advances in science, education and pharmaceutical practice.
